I would feel more comfortable with the proposed mechanism if it allowed the .py files to retain their original names. There is a ton of collateral out there referring people to ez_setup.py, and while I can (and will) redirect the original URL to wherever it ends up, it'd be less confusing to keep the name. Among other things, it would help prevent the sort of phishing attack where somebody represents *their* ez_setup.py script as the real deal, while saying that setuptools/bootstrap.py is an obvious forgery, since it's not named ez_setup.py. ;-) _______________________________________________ Catalog-SIG mailing list Catalog-SIG@python.org http://mail.python.org/mailman/listinfo/catalog-sig
